Prabhava was 30 years old when he took initiation. Whether he was married or not, there is no mention of it in any text. After initiation Prabhava thoroughly studied all the 11 Amgas and 14 Prvas from Sudharm Swm and Jamb Sw m. He performed severe austerities, and in the blazing flame of penance he started burning his bad karma like firewood. Serving rya Sudharm he followed the rama a Dharma. In V.N. 64, Prabhava was made c rya by Jamb Sw m. After the nirv a of Jamb Sw m , Prabhava Sw m took over as Pontiff. He not only elevated himself in the spiritual path but also served the congregation, following the principles of Lord Mah v ra with unflinching faith and devotion, and glorified Jainism setting an example for others by his conduct as a Pontiff of that time Contemplation about the successor One day, at night crya Prabhava Swm was deep in meditation. The rest of the ascetics were fast asleep. After his meditation in the middle of the night he reflected on the issue of his successor. He was perplexed as to whom the responsibility of a successor should be entrusted to administer the large congregation efficiently as per the guidelines of Lord Mah v ra. He mentally recollected all the ascetics of the congregation and visualised them to be his successor; but much to his dismay, he could not find anyone fit to the rank. Then he started thinking of the people outside the religion who are eligible to run the congregation. With his intuition he found out that Sayyambhava Bha a, a staunch Brahmin of Vatsa Gotra, a resident of R jag ha and who was engaged in performing the sacrificial rites, was proficient in all aspects to run the congregation.
